Why casino is legal in GOA

Goa allows casinos due to tourism boost. Local economy benefits. Regulations in place for responsible gambling.

Government earns revenue from taxes. Casinos create job opportunities. Attracts high-end tourists.

Casinos in Goa follow strict guidelines. Promotes entertainment industry. Boosts overall economy.

Regulation and control measures in place

Casinos are subject to strict regulations to ensure fair play and prevent fraud. These measures include licensing requirements and regular audits.

Regulatory bodies monitor casinos to ensure they comply with laws and regulations. This helps protect players and maintain the integrity of the industry.

Control measures such as age restrictions and self-exclusion programs are in place to promote responsible gambling and prevent addiction.
